What type of ship is this?

SKANDI HERCULES (IMO 9435739) is a Oil service/AHTS ship built in 2010 and is sailing under the flag of Bahamas. She has an overall length (LOA) of 109 meters and a width (beam) of 24 meters. Her summer deadweight capacity is 5,750 tonnes.
